Sr. Data Engineer - Ecommerce (Remote) at CrowdStrike, Inc. (Sunnyvale, CA)

Sr. Data Engineer - Ecommerce (Remote) at CrowdStrike, Inc. (Sunnyvale, CA)

Add To Bookmarks
Location: Sunnyvale, CA
Type: Full Time
Created: 2021-01-02 05:01:29

Apply Here

At CrowdStrike were on a mission - to stop breaches. Our groundbreaking technology, services delivery, and intelligence gathering together with our innovations in machine learning and behavioral-based detection, allow our customers to not only defend themselves, but do so in a future-proof manner. Weve earned numerous honors and top rankings for our technology, organization and people clearly confirming our industry leadership and our special culture driving it. We also offer flexible work arrangements to help our people manage their personal and professional lives in a way that works for them. So if youre ready to work on unrivaled technology where your desire to be part of a collaborative team is met with a laser-focused mission to stop breaches and protect people globally, lets talk.

About the Role:

We're spinning up a brand new team and initiative at CrowdStrike to focus on Ecommerce. We'll be covering areas like the CrowdStrike App Marketplace and monetization (in-app purchasing/micro-transactions/etc), creative new ways to approach Licensing, Billing and Entitlement across the entire product portfolio, and all the backend analytics work to drive a better user experience and optimize engagement, conversion, cross-sell and up-sell. We'll also be spearheading the creation of new CrowdStrike offerings that are built on the existing world-class Falcon platform but target a completely ecommerce driven, low-touch, high engagement product experience. If you're passionate about building intuitive applications that customers will rave about, tell their friends about and can't wait to use daily, we want you on our team.

As a Data Engineer on the CrowdStrike Ecommerce team, you will be involved in building data systems at scale that ingest billions of events, decisions and transactions every day. In this role, you will help make it possible for internal and external customers to easily work with data we produce at massive scale. You will be part of a data platform team that is continuously developing and improving product features to protect our customers from increasingly complex threat actors attempting data breaches.

Job Responsibilities:

  • Design, develop, and maintain workflows that can process petabytes of data
  • Use advanced data analysis techniques and architectures that leverage technology to process large volumes of data to perform complex computations in a scalable, reproducible and automated manner.
  • Help us research and implement new ways for appropriate stakeholders to query their data efficiently and extract results in the format they desire
  • Participate in technical reviews of our products and help us develop new features and enhance stability
  • Continually help us improve the efficiency of our services so that we can delight our customers

Qualifications for Data Engineer:

We are looking for a candidate with a BS and 5+ years or MS and 3+ years in Computer Science or related field. They should also have experience with the following software/tools -

  • A solid understanding of algorithms, distributed systems design and the software development lifecycle
  • Experience with relational SQL and NoSQL databases, including Postgres/MySQL, Cassandra, DynamoDB
  • Solid background in Web application development (C#, Java/Scala, Go, Node.JS) and scripting languages like Python
  • Golang experience is desirable
  • Experience building large scale data pipelines
  • Good test-driven development discipline
  • Reasonable proficiency with Linux administration tools
  • Proven ability to work effectively with remote teams 

Experience with the following tools is desirable:

  • Strong familiarity with the Apache Hadoop ecosystem including: Spark, Kafka, Hive, etc
  • Recent hands-on experience with modern data platforms such as SQL, RDMS, or Graph DBs, and Data Visualization skills using BI tools such as Tableau, Power BI, Domo, or D3.
  • Kubernetes
  • Jenkins




Benefits of Working at CrowdStrike:

  • Market leader in compensation and equity awards
  • Competitive vacation policy
  • Comprehensive health benefits + 401k plan 
  • Paid parental leave, including adoption
  • Flexible work environment
  • Wellness programs
  • Stocked fridges, coffee, soda, and lots of treats

We are committed to building an inclusive culture of belonging that not only embraces the diversity of our people but also reflects the diversity of the communities in which we work and the customers we serve. We know that the happiest and highest performing teams include people with diverse perspectives and ways of solving problems so we strive to attract and retain talent from all backgrounds and create workplaces where everyone feels empowered to bring their full, authentic selves to work.

CrowdStrike is an Equal Op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, sex including sexual orientation and gender identity, national origin, disability, protected veteran status, or any other characteristic protected by applicable federal, state, or local law.

CrowdStrike participates in the E-Verify program.

Notice of E-Verify Participation

Right to Work